How to Create a Form From Excel

Four steps. No coding. Your formulas stay intact.

1

Open your Excel workbook

Sign in to Airrange and open your .xlsx file. Works with local files and Microsoft 365. Nothing gets uploaded — everything runs in your browser.

2

Drag & drop form fields

Select which cells become input fields (text, dropdown, slider, checkbox) and which cells show calculated results. Link each field to a cell in your spreadsheet.

3

Customize the design

Add your logo, labels, rich text descriptions, and validation rules. Arrange fields across multiple pages with navigation buttons.

4

Publish & share

Click publish. Share via link, embed on your website, or add to Microsoft Teams. Anyone can fill in the form — on any device, no Excel needed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I create a form from an existing Excel file?

Yes. Open your .xlsx file in Airrange, select the cells you want as form fields, and publish. All your existing formulas continue working.

Do users need Excel to fill in the form?

No. The form is a web application accessible via any browser — desktop, tablet, or mobile. Users never see or need Excel.

Can I embed the form on my website?

Yes. Every Airrange form can be embedded on any website via an iframe embed code. The form is fully responsive.

Can the form show calculated results?

Yes. Unlike Microsoft Forms, Airrange forms can display calculated results in real-time. As users fill in fields, your Excel formulas run and show the output — perfect for calculators, quotes, and pricing tools.

Is the data stored securely?

Your Excel file never leaves your device. Airrange processes everything locally in your browser. Shared forms use encrypted runtime packages stored on EU servers (AWS Frankfurt). Fully GDPR-compliant.

How is this different from Microsoft Forms?

Microsoft Forms is a standalone form tool — it doesn't use your Excel formulas. Airrange forms ARE your Excel file with a web interface on top. Your formulas, charts, and logic stay active. Users fill in the form, Excel calculates the results.
